Project Overview

MoonLog is an interactive, mindful mood-tracking web application designed to help users navigate their emotional landscape through intuitive daily logging and reflective journaling. By transforming abstract feelings into visual patterns, the platform bridges the gap between daily emotional fluctuations and long-term mental clarity.

My contribution

As the Product Designer and Front-end Developer for MoodLog, I led the project from conceptual narrative to a functional, high-fidelity web application by integrating UX research, emotional storytelling, and technical implementation. My work included defining the project's narrative structure and user personas to ensure an empathetic interface, while also architecting the "Mood Booth" flow to simplify traditional mood-tracking into a cohesive three-module experience. On the design side, I established the visual identity through custom emotion icons and a responsive, card-based layout featuring contextual feedback loops for tailored user reflection. Technically, I co-developed the application using HTML5, CSS3, and Vanilla JavaScript, ensuring high-fidelity design restoration and engineering data persistence via localStorage and sessionStorage to allow local journal archiving without a complex backend

The Challenge

Overcoming "Journaling Fatigue"Traditional mood-tracking apps often feel like a chore, leading to high drop-off rates. Our research identified that users feel overwhelmed by blank pages and clinical interfaces.

Vanilla JavaScript Interactions

I engineered the interaction model using pure Vanilla JavaScript to handle complex state changes without dependencies.

Hover-Based Definitions: Utilizing hover-script.js, I implemented event listeners that dynamically update the UI based on cursor position, offering immediate emotional definitions.


Contextual Feedback Loops: Programmed conditional logic to trigger "speech bubble" prompts that adapt to previous input, creating a conversational UI.

Client-Side Persistence

Given the sensitive nature of mood tracking, I prioritized user privacy by architecting a "Zero-Backend" solution using the Web Storage API.

Local & Session Storage: User data is serialized via JSON.stringify and stored directly within the browser.


Data Sovereignty: Personal journal entries never leave the user's device, creating a secure archive without requiring login credentials.

High-Fidelity Transition

Translating the design from Figma to code required a strict adherence to semantic HTML and modern CSS methodologies.


Responsive Fluidity

I utilized Flexbox architecture and CSS Media Queries to ensure the layout adapts fluidly. The "Mood Booth" module resizes grid elements dynamically, maintaining touch targets on mobile while utilizing whitespace effectively on desktop.


Pixel Perfection

The build maintains 1:1 fidelity with the high-definition prototypes, ensuring that gradients, shadows, and transition timings were implemented exactly as envisioned.
